The Origins of Audiology

Audiology's roots can be traced back to ancient times when civilizations like the Egyptians and Greeks first began to recognize and document hearing impairments. However, it wasn't up until the 19th century that the research study of hearing handled a more clinical approach. The innovation of the ear trumpet in the late 18th century, a fundamental gadget designed to amplify sound for the hard of hearing, marked among the earliest efforts to resolve hearing loss.

The Birth of Modernized Audiology

The turning point for audiology followed World War II, as thousands of veterans returned home with noise-induced hearing loss triggered by exposure to loud surges and equipment. This developed an immediate requirement for reliable treatments and rehab services, catalyzing the establishment of audiology as an official occupation. Audiologists began with basic diagnostic tests to examine hearing loss and quickly moved towards developing more sophisticated audiometric methods.

Technological Improvements and Essential Discoveries

A significant breakthrough in the field of audiology occurred with the innovation of the electronic hearing aid in the 20th century. Initially, these gadgets were cumbersome and had limited capabilities, however the intro of digital innovation in the latter part of the century changed the style of hearing aids, resulting in smaller, more potent, and higher-fidelity devices that could provide a more accurate sound experience.

The 1970s saw a substantial improvement with the advancement of cochlear implants, which are advanced electronic gadgets that can promote the auditory nerve to help individuals with severe deafness who do not benefit from regular hearing aids. Over the years, audiological research study has actually widened to check out not only the physical elements of hearing loss however likewise the mental and social effects, acknowledging how hearing problems can affect communication, thinking, and overall well-being. This broadened viewpoint on hearing health has actually promoted a more inclusive treatment technique that integrates technical interventions with therapy and auditory rehabilitation.

The Current Digital Era and Beyond

Currently, audiology is at the forefront of the digital age, with progress in expert system (AI), telehealth, and individualized medication influencing the direction of hearing healthcare. Contemporary hearing gadgets such as hearing help and cochlear implants use AI technology to adjust to various environments, providing a high degree of clarity and personalization. The availability of tele-audiology services, enabled by web connections, has actually increased the ease of access of hearing care by enabling remote examinations, fittings, and conversations.
